Pergunta

Estou estudando o novo produto Amazon RDS e parece que pode ser escalado apenas na vertical (isto é, colocar um servidor mais forte).

Alguém viu a possibilidade de casos configure múltiplas para que um é mestre e o outro / s é / são escravos de replicação?

Foi útil?

Solução

A mesma pergunta feita (e respondeu) aqui http: //developer.amazonwebservices .com / connect / thread.jspa? threadID = 37823

Parece que há planos para Master-Master HA ou semelhante, mas isso não é o mesmo de uma oferta scale-out replicados.

Outras dicas

De acordo com o FAQ é possível agora, veja http://aws.amazon.com / RDS / faqs / # 86 :

Q: Que tipos de replicação faz apoio Amazon RDS e quando eu deveria usar cada um?

Amazon RDS fornece duas opções de replicação distintos para servir diferentes propósitos.

Se você estiver olhando para replicação uso para aumentar a base de dados disponibilidade, protegendo seu atualizações mais recentes do banco de dados contra interrupções não planejadas, considere executar seu DB Instância como um Multi-AZ desdobramento, desenvolvimento. Quando você criar ou modificar seu DB Instância para executar como um Multi-AZ implantação, Amazon RDS vontade automaticamente provisionar e gerenciar um réplica “de espera” de uma forma diferente Disponibilidade Zone (independente infra-estrutura em um fisicamente local separado). No evento de manutenção de banco de dados de planeamento, DB falha da instância, ou um Disponibilidade falha Zone, Amazon RDS vontade automaticamente failover para o modo de espera de modo que as operações da base de dados pode retomar rapidamente sem administrativa intervenção. implantações Multi-AZ utilizar a replicação síncrona, fazendo banco de dados grava simultaneamente em tanto o primário e de espera para que a espera será up-to-date na evento ocorre um failover. enquanto o nosso implementação tecnológica para Instâncias Multi-AZ DB maximiza dados durabilidade em cenários de falha, ele opõe-se à espera de ser acedida directamente ou usada para leitura operações. A tolerância a falhas oferecido pelo Multi-AZ implementações make -los um ajuste natural para a produção ambientes; para aprender mais sobre implantações Multi-AZ, visite por favor Nesta seção FAQ.

Se você estiver olhando para tirar proveito do MySQL 5.1 está embutido replicação para além da escala restrições de capacidade de uma única DB Instância de banco de dados read-pesado cargas de trabalho, Amazon RDS torna mais fácil com réplicas de leitura. Você pode criar um Leia réplica de um determinado “fonte” DB Instância usando o AWS Management Console ou CreateDBInstanceReadReplica API. Uma vez que a réplica de leitura é criado, atualizações de banco de dados no DB fonte Instância será propagada para o Leia Replica. Você pode criar múltiplos Leia Réplicas para um determinado DB fonte Instância e distribuir o seu tráfego de leitura do aplicativo entre eles. Ao contrário de implantações Multi-AZ, Leia Réplicas usar MySQL 5.1 de built-in replicação e estão sujeitas a sua pontos fortes e limitações. No particular, as atualizações são aplicadas a seu Leia Replica (s) depois que eles ocorrem na fonte de DB Instância (Replicação “assíncrono”), e lag replicação pode variar significativamente. Isto significa recente atualizações de banco de dados feitas a um padrão fonte (não Multi-AZ) DB Instância pode não estar presente em Leia associado Réplicas em caso de não planejada falha na fonte de DB Instance. Como tais, Leia Replicas não oferecem a mesmos benefícios de durabilidade como dados Multi-AZ implantações. enquanto Leia Réplicas podem fornecer alguma leitura benefícios de disponibilidade, eles e são Não projetado para melhorar a escrita disponibilidade.

Com o Amazon RDS, você pode usar as implantações Multi-AZ e ler Replicas em conjunto para aproveitar o vantagens complementares de cada. Vocês pode simplesmente especificar que um determinado implantação Multi-AZ é o DB fonte Instância para o seu Leia Replica (s). Dessa forma, você ganha tanto os dados benefícios de durabilidade e disponibilidade das implantações Multi-AZ e da leitura benefícios de escala de leitura réplicas.

Licenciado em: CC-BY-SA com atribuição
Não afiliado a StackOverflow
scroll top